Check out Harlem World Magazine picks of the stars and movies that made the nominees of the 83rd Oscars cut (see astericks):
Best Picture
- Black Swan *
- The Fighter
- Inception
- The Kids Are All Right
- The King’s Speech
- 127 Hours
- The Social Network
- Toy Story 3
- True Grit
- Winter’s Bone
Best Actor
- Javier Bardem, Biutiful
- Jeff Bridges, True Grit
- Jesse Eisenberg, The Social Network
- Colin Firth, The King’s Speech *
- James Franco, 127 Hours
Best Actress
- Annette Bening, The Kids Are All Right *
- Nicole Kidman, Rabbit Hole
- Jennifer Lawrence, Winter’s Bone
- Natalie Portman, Black Swan
- Michelle Williams, Blue Valentine
Best Supporting Actor
- Christian Bale, The Fighter
- John Hawkes, Winter’s Bone
- Jeremy Renner, The Town
- Mark Ruffalo, The Kids Are All Right *
- Geoffrey Rush, The King’s Speech
Best Supporting Actress
- Amy Adams, The Fighter
- Helena Bonham Carter, The King’s Speech *
- Melissa Leo, The Fighter
- Hailee Steinfeld, True Grit
- Jacki Weaver, Animal Kingdom
Best Director
- Darren Aronofsky, Black Swan
- Joel and Ethan Coen, True Grit
- David Fincher, The Social Network *
- Tom Hooper, The King’s Speech
- David O. Russell, The Fighter
Best Original Screenplay
- Another Year
- The Fighter
- Inception
- The King’s Speech *
- The Kids Are All Right
Best Adapted Screenplay
- 127 Hours
- The Social Network *
- Toy Story 3
- True Grit
- Winter’s Bone
